Applications are invited for the post of a Carpenter within the site based Estates Operational Maintenance team.

To provide a safe, comfortable environment for patients, staff and visitors.


Ensuring all essential services are maintained to support clinical departments in their prime task of treating patients whilst ensuring all statutory legislation is complied with.

Ensure maintenance tasks are fulfilled.

Responsible for fault finding and repairing a wide range of building elements and undertaking certain elements of multi-skilling:

a) Fire doors
b) Locks and security
c) Roofing
d) Leaks
e) Minor developments
f) Windows
g) Other associated building skills. Mark out accurately and construct from drawing & plans
h) Knowledge of current building regulations


The Carpenter will be part of a maintenance team ensuring that the building environment is kept to its optimum condition, and that services are maintained to an appropriate standard to support clinical service departments in their prime task of treating patients.

The Carpenter will also be expected to work to Health Board standards supporting the C4C audits.


The appointed individual will support the site operational management staff with the day-to-day operational engineering and building maintenance which will include engineering services, buildings, grounds and gardens etc.

The position requires degree of flexibility depending on the needs of the service.

Hywel Dda University Health Board is the planner and provider of NHS healthcare services for people in Carmarthenshire, Ceredigion, Pembrokeshire and its bordering counties.

Our 11,000 members of staff provide primary, community, in-hospital, mental health and learning disabilities services for around 384,000 people across a quarter of the landmass of Wales.

We do this in partnership with our three local authorities and public, private and third sector colleagues, including our volunteers, through:


Four main hospitals:
Bronglais General in Aberystwyth, Glangwili General in Carmarthen, Prince Philip in Llanelli and Withybush General in Haverfordwest;

Seven community hospitals:
Amman Valley and Llandovery in Carmarthenshire; Tregaron, Aberaeron and Cardigan in Ceredigion; and Tenby and South Pembrokeshire Hospital Health and Social Care Resource Centre in Pembrokeshire;
48 general practices (four of which are managed practices), 47 dental practices (including three orthodontic), 99 community pharmacies, 44 general ophthalmic practices (43 providing Eye Health Examination Wales and 34 low vision services) and 17 domiciliary only providers and 11 health centres;
Numerous locations providing mental health and learning disabilities services;

Highly specialised and tertiary services commissioned by the Welsh Health Specialised Services Committee, a joint committee representing seven health boards across Wales.
